    Moab 6-Hour Guided Canyoneering Tour

    Tackle Moab’s longest canyon route with three guided rappels

    4.9 stars• 1.9K reviews
    From$196/ personincl. taxes and fees

    Duration

    6 hours

    Includes

    Guides, gear, transportation

    Highlights

    Explore a remote Moab canyon with three rappels, a narrow slot, potholes, and easy scrambling. Current August conditions include thigh- to waist-deep pools from monsoon rains, so expect your clothes to get wet.

    • Descend three rappels up to 160 feet with guide support
    • Navigate a tight slot, potholes, and uneven canyon terrain
    • See seldom-seen arches, ancient ruins, and petroglyphs
    • Scramble through a remote desert canyon route

    What's Included

    • American Mountain Guides Association-certified Single Pitch Instructors
    • Helmet
    • Harness
    • Gloves
    • Transportation
    • Parking

    Important details

    • Ages 12+ only
    • Requires hiking about 5 miles, scrambling, navigating uneven terrain, and completing all three rappels
    • Complete all rappels; there is no route around them or return to the start once the hike begins
    • Arrive at your scheduled time; departures leave no later than 15 minutes afterward
    • Bring 3 liters of water per person in summer, plus snacks or lunch
    • Wear running shoes, trail runners, or strapped sandals comfortable for 5 miles; footwear may get wet
    • Use the provided technical equipment
    • Complete the required waiver before departure
    • Alcohol is prohibited on the trip

    Bring a water bottle or hydration bladder, 1–2 liters of water per person (3 liters in summer), snacks or lunch, sunblock, sunglasses, a camera, and a day pack large enough to carry your water, food, and helmet.

    Wear running shoes, trail runners, or strapped sandals (Keen- or Teva-type). Expect your footwear to get wet and make sure it stays comfortable for about 5 miles of hiking.

    No. Alcohol is prohibited on all Red River trips. If you violate this policy, they will cancel your trip without a refund.
